In West Malaysia and Sarawak, wills are controlled by the Wills Act 1959.
158) uses. The Wills Act 1959 and the Wills Regulation uses to non-Muslims just. Area 2( 2) of the blog Wills Act 1959 states that the Act does not use to wills of individuals professing the religion of Islam.
In Malaysia, an individual composing a will certainly have to adhere to the formalities stated in Section 5 of the Wills Act 1959 in order for the will to be legitimate and efficient. Under the Wills Act 1959, the youngest age to compose a Will is when he/she is 18 years of ages, whereas for Sabah, it is 21 years of ages.
At the time of finalizing, he needs to not be under pressure or unnecessary impact. Furthermore, when the Will is signed by the testator, there should be at least two witnesses that go to the very least 18 years of ages, of audio mind and they are not visually impaired. The function of the witnesses is only to prove that the testator authorized his/her Will.

Testator should be at the age of majority., the age of majority read this post here is 21 years old as mentioned under Section 4 of the Wills Regulation 1953.
Creating a brand-new will: only the most recent will would be identified as the valid one by the courts Declaration handwritten of a purpose to revoke the will: the testator makes a created statement about their objective to withdraw the will. The said statement has to be authorized by the testator in the presence of two witnesses.
Deliberate devastation: pursuant to Area 14 of the Wills Act of Malaysia a will certainly can be burned, ripped or otherwise deliberately damaged by the testator or a 3rd celebration in the presence of the testator and under their instructions, with the purpose to withdraw the will. If a person passes away without a will, the Circulation Act 1958 (which was changed in 1997) uses.
